On the second day of the Gamescom, I didn't play as many games as before, but bigger titles instead. Meaning I spent more time in queues. It was still a lot of fun though, and most of the games were worth the wait. Super Smash Bros. Ultimate by Nintendo The day began with a blast and I onlay had to wait 10 minutes to play it. I dare saying that probably not everyone was as lucky as me, since most of the time there was a big queue of 5/6 hours. Smash Bros. Ultimate was exactly what you would expect from it: Quick fun, not too many suprises. I found the game to feel more responsive to my input than Smah Brow. Wii U and overall it felt more fluent. A safe buy for me, and I won both rounds I got to play, so there's a chance that I won't do to bad in the game. Team Sonic Racing by Sega Now this is a game I didn't thought I would play. Or like. Commonly in JRPGs there are two ways to handle a protagonist: Either you make him a somewhat bland character so every player can easily identify with him or you make him a strong character, risking that not everyone identifies with him. Stocke is somewhat inbetween. While he is calm, he definitly has his own character. Every choice the player makes for him are choices that fit the picture the player constructed when seeing him. Just don`t trust those with a moustache.  Summary: Professor Layton and the Curious Village is a puzzle adventure game developed by Level-5, which released on February 15, 2007 on the DS. In the game you play as, who would have guessed, Professor Hershel Layton and his somewhat obnoxious apprentice. Layton is a archaeology professor in London with a knack for solving puzzles. When he get`s a mysterious letter asking for help in an inheritance dispute and the search of a golden apple, he can`t resist.
